“Jerusalem Car-Ramming Attack Near Mahane Yehuda Market: Latest News & Updates”

2023-04-24 16:28:53

A car-ramming attack took place on Monday near the Mahane Yehuda market in Jerusalem.

The balance sheet is five injured, including a sexagenarian seriously injured. A woman in her thirties, shot in the face, is in moderate condition, while three other people were slightly injured.

The terrorist, a Palestinian from East Jerusalem, was neutralized by an armed passerby. He is a resident of Beit Safafa, father of five children.

“When we arrived at the scene, we saw a 70-year-old man lying on the road near the suspect vehicle in a vague state of consciousness. We found that he suffered from bruises to his head and limbs. “we evacuated to Shaare Zedek Hospital. His condition is serious but stable,” the emergency services said.

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u speaks at an opening ceremony of Remembrance Day events, during which Israel commemorates the victims of war and terrorism.

“A few minutes ago, not far from here, there was another attempt to assassinate Israeli citizens. It reminds us that the land and the State of Israel were acquired at the cost of much suffering,” he asserted. “These terrorist attacks are carried out in the hope of defeating us and uprooting us from here, and if they could, they would murder us all. But they will not defeat us, we will defeat them. We have established an exemplary state with an exemplary army and police,” he added.

“I congratulate the citizen who neutralized the terrorist and saved many lives. The State of Israel thanks you because you have prevented a very big catastrophe. I gave the order to facilitate the carrying of weapons in order to so that the population can protect themselves,” said National Security Minister Itamar Ben Gvir.
